pub struct RunFinishedPayload {
pub thread_id: ContextId,
pub run_id: TaskId,
pub result: Option<Value>,
}Fields§
§thread_id: ContextId§run_id: TaskId§result: Option<Value>Trait Implementations§
Source§impl Clone for RunFinishedPayload
impl Clone for RunFinishedPayload
Source§fn clone(&self) -> RunFinishedPayload
fn clone(&self) -> RunFinishedPayload
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for RunFinishedPayload
impl Debug for RunFinishedPayload
Source§impl<'de> Deserialize<'de> for RunFinishedPayload
impl<'de> Deserialize<'de> for RunFinishedPayload
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for RunFinishedPayload
impl RefUnwindSafe for RunFinishedPayload
impl Send for RunFinishedPayload
impl Sync for RunFinishedPayload
impl Unpin for RunFinishedPayload
impl UnwindSafe for RunFinishedPayload
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more